Quick answer

Baiju Patti is a village in Tamkuhi Raj Tehsil of Kushinagar district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 189709.

About Baiju Patti village record

Baiju Patti is listed under Tamkuhi Raj Tehsil in Kushinagar district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 1,517, 215 households, area 112.76 hectares, PIN code 000000.

Baiju Patti village Census details
FieldValue
Village nameBaiju Patti
Census village code189709
StateUttar Pradesh
State code09
DistrictKushinagar
District code189
Tehsil / Sub-DistrictTamkuhi Raj
Sub-district code00958
Census year2011
Population1,517
Households215
Male population792
Female population725
Sex ratio915 females per 1,000 males
Scheduled Castes population38
Scheduled Tribes population0
Area112.76 hectares
Population density1,345 people per sq. km
PIN code000000
CD blockSevarhi
Gram panchayatBaiju Patti Mathia
Nearest statutory townKushinagar
Nearest statutory town distance8 km

Facilities and amenities in Baiju Patti

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Baiju Patti
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re0 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ital0 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
CommunicationSub post officeN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
CommunicationMobile phone coverageAvailable in village
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Pucca roadAvailable in village
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esASHA workerAvailable in village
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 8 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yAvailable in village; 8 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ersAvailable in village; 8 hours/day
Land-use details reported for Baiju Patti
Land-use fieldCensus 2011 value
Non-agricultural use area26.14 hectares
Barren / uncultivable land33.14 hectares
Culturable waste land0.90 hectares
Current fallow land0.40 hectares
Net area sown50.55 hectares
Irrigated area50.55 hectares
Canal-irrigated area20.55 hectares
Wells / tube-wells irrigated area30 hectares
